The Musqueam Indian Band is a First Nation government and community based in Vancouver, British Columbia. It serves over 1,300 members and is situated on the Musqueam Indian Reserve near the mouth of the Fraser River within the Metro Vancouver region. The Band's core functions include serving its members and managing cultural, traditional, and land rights.
Musqueam has maintained strong cultural and traditional practices throughout its history. The Band is recognized as a leader in innovative approaches to negotiation and partnerships, forging new paths toward self-governance.
Its operations and responsibilities encompass a broad range of governmental and community services dedicated to the well-being and interests of its membership.
